How to Photograph Football (Soccer) - Michael Berkeley …

    https://www.michaelberkeleyphoto.uk/new-blog/how-to-photograph-football-soccer
    I usually use a 70-200mm (f2.8) lens and/or a 200-600mm (f5.6-f/6.3) lens. Reducing the depth of field provides a degree of separation between the players and the background. Next I set the shutter speed depending on how bright the day is, but it will usually be faster than 1/1000th sec for football in order to freeze the action.

The Perfect Camera Settings for Action and Sports …

    https://www.photographymad.com/pages/view/the-perfect-camera-settings-for-action-and-sports-photography
    Start by putting your camera into Shutter Priority mode and choosing a shutter speed of 1/500 of a second. This is a good starting point and should be fast enough for most sports and action. If possible, take a few test shots before the main event starts so …

Better Sports Photography Settings by Sport | Nikon

    https://www.nikonusa.com/en/learn-and-explore/a/tips-and-techniques/better-sports-photography.html
    To counter this, set your camera’s settings to the following: AF-C Priority Selection to RELEASE, AF-Area Mode to DYNAMIC AREA AF (9 points) and Focus Tracking with lock-on to 3 (normal). When photographing sports where subjects are often obscured by other athletes for example at a track event select a long lock-on to maintain focus on your subject.
